Software Description:

- linux-lts-trusty: Linux hardware enablement kernel from Trusty for Precise

Details:

Justin Yackoski discovered that the Atheros L2 Ethernet Driver in the Linux

kernel incorrectly enables scatter/gather I/O. A remote attacker could use

this to obtain potentially sensitive information from kernel memory.

(CVE-2016-2117)

Jann Horn discovered that eCryptfs improperly attempted to use the mmap()

handler of a lower filesystem that did not implement one, causing a

recursive page fault to occur. A local unprivileged attacker could use to

cause a denial of service (system cr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code

with administrative privileges. (CVE-2016-1583)

Jason A. Donenfeld discovered multiple out-of-bounds reads in the OZMO USB

over wifi device drivers in the Linux kernel. A remote attacker could use

this to cause a denial of service (system crash) or obtain potentially

Update Instructions

The problem can be corrected by updating your system to the following
package versions:

Ubuntu 12.04 LTS:
  linux-image-3.13.0-88-generic   3.13.0-88.135~precise1
  linux-image-3.13.0-88-generic-lpae  3.13.0-88.135~precise1

After a standard system update you need to reboot your computer to make
all the necessary changes.

ATTENTION: Due to an unavoidable ABI change the kernel updates have
been given a new version number, which requires you to recompile and
reinstall all third party kernel modules you might have installed.
Unless you manually uninstalled the standard kernel metapackages
(e.g. linux-generic, linux-generic-lts-RELEASE, linux-virtual,
linux-powerpc), a standard system upgrade will automatically perform
this as well.
